    It sounds like a cache issue. When you view the page, that
    page is loaded into your (or your client's) browser's cache memory.
    This is done so that when you return to that page it will load
    faster (since it is already loaded into memory).
    This will only happen if a person has been to the page
    recently. There is a limit on the amount of information your
    browser will store in cache memory. The more you surf, the more
    likely it is that the page will be replaced in the cache memory
    with some other information.
    You (and your client) can, depending on what browser you are
    using, set your preferences so that all web pages will be
    completely reloaded every time you visit them. In IE 6 for Win:
    Tools>Internet Options>Settings> Select 'Every visit to
    the page'. You can also set your cache to be the minimum amount of
    space alotted. Note: This doesn't really work very well in IE 6 for
    WIN. I use firefox for reviewing changes because I have found IE 6
    is completely unreliable for viewing the latest.
    Most other browsers will allow you to hold down Shift and hit
    'refresh' to throw out the cache for that page and view the latest.
    As far as I know this is standard operating procedure for proofing
    new pages.
    If there is a coding technique to force a browser to use only
    the latest information, I don't know what it is.
